How to Make Cherry Jam in Strawberry Shortcake
Now that we’ve talked about why cherry jam is such a great addition to strawberry shortcake, let’s talk about how you can make it at home. Don’t worry, it’s easier than you think. All you need is a few simple ingredients and a little bit of patience. Trust me, it’s worth it.
What You’ll Need
- 2 cups of fresh strawberries, sliced
- 1 cup of cherry jam
- 2 cups of whipped cream
- 1 sponge cake or shortcake, sliced into layers
- A pinch of sugar (optional)
Step-by-Step Guide
Alright, let’s get to it. Here’s how you can make cherry jam in strawberry shortcake:
- Start by preparing your sponge cake or shortcake. If you’re using a store-bought one, make sure it’s fresh and of good quality.
- Next, slice the cake into layers. This will make it easier to add the filling.
- Spread a layer of cherry jam on the bottom layer of the cake. Don’t be shy, use as much as you like.
- Add a layer of sliced strawberries on top of the cherry jam. You can sprinkle a little sugar if you want it sweeter.
- Repeat the process with the next layer of cake, adding more cherry jam and strawberries.
- Once you’ve added all the layers, top it off with whipped cream. You can be as generous as you like with this part.
- Finally, garnish with a few fresh strawberries and a dollop of cherry jam. Voila! Your dessert is ready to serve.

Tips for Making the Perfect Cherry Jam in Strawberry Shortcake
Now that you know how to make cherry jam in strawberry shortcake, here are a few tips to make it even better:
- Use fresh, ripe strawberries for the best flavor.
- Make sure your cherry jam is of good quality. Homemade jam is always a plus.
- Don’t be afraid to experiment with different types of cake. Sponge cake is traditional, but pound cake or even angel food cake can work too.
- Whipped cream is a must, but you can also try using mascarpone or cream cheese for a different twist.

Fun Facts About Cherry Jam in Strawberry Shortcake
Here are a few fun facts about cherry jam in strawberry shortcake:
- Cherries are one of the oldest fruits known to man, with evidence of cultivation dating back to 3,000 BC.
- Strawberry shortcake was first mentioned in a cookbook in the 1850s.
- Cherry jam is often made with Montmorency cherries, which are known for their tart flavor.
- Strawberries are the only fruit with seeds on the outside.
